Vagus

Referring to the vagus nerve, the tenth cranial nerve, which innervates major organs, including the heart, lungs, and digestive tract.

Trigeminal

Pertaining to the trigeminal nerve, which is responsible for sensation in the face and motor functions such as biting and chewing.

Cheek

Side of the face forming the lateral wall of the mouth.

Trigeminal Nerve

A cranial nerve responsible for sensation in the face and motor functions such as biting and chewing.
